Watch-outs for mobile massage therapists in Forest Gate (Newham)
- CThA, FHT or SMTO membership does not affect card acceptance but clients ask.
- Booking-app integration (Treatwell, Fresha) affects deposit handling.
- No-show deposit policy needs card-on-file with consent capture.

How much does a card machine cost for a mobile massage therapist in Forest Gate (Newham)?
Hardware ranges from £0 (Tap to Pay on iPhone) to £329 (Stripe Reader S700). Per-transaction rate from 0.74% (Tyl by NatWest for NatWest banking customers) to 1.95% (SumUp standard). Monthly fees from £0 (no-contract products) to £25+ (Dojo, Worldpay). At typical mobile massage therapists volume in Forest Gate (Newham) (£45 to £120 per transaction, ~60% contactless), expect a blended monthly cost between £40 and £400.
